Creating a Compelling Dating Profile
The first step to finding a date is creating a compelling dating profile. Here are some online dating tips to help you get started.
- Put your best self forward: Your online dating profile is the first impression you have on someone, so make it count! There’s no need to be modest or shy, but make sure that you’re being honest and putting your best self forward.
- Include a clear and concise description of yourself: It might sound obvious, but it’s important to include a clear and concise description of yourself in your profile. This will give people an idea of who they’re talking to before they message you.
- Be upfront about what you’re looking for in a partner: It’s important for both parties to know what they want out of the relationship early on- because it can save time and heartache later on down the line. If you want something casual, say so up front! If you want something serious, let that be known too!

Approaching Women Who Interest You
Approaching women in public is not easy for many people, but it can be done with a specific approach.
The first step to approaching women in public is to be confident. The way you carry yourself and your posture will greatly affect how she feels about you and the interaction. Try to stand up straight, have your shoulders back, and keep your head high. This will make you feel more confident and less nervous about speaking with her.
The second step is to make eye contact with her before going up to talk to her. Eye contact is important because it shows that you are interested in talking with her, while also making you seem more confident by showing that you are able to hold a conversation without getting nervous or distracted easily. It also shows that you are interested in what she has been doing or thinking about for the past few minutes which can help break the ice between the two of you when starting a conversation together.
Finally, you need to remember that patience is the key to success. When it comes to dating you cannot force anyone to do anything. Once you have shown them your interest the rest is in her hands. Be real and patient and with a small amount of luck you will have the results you are looking for.
